I've looked into saving seeds. Might be difficult for some things, crossbreeding/cross pollination. Brassica's, kale,broccoli, cauliflower, collards all will cross breed, pumpkins with summer squash and winter squash, carrots with queen anne's lace. I plant two varieties of tomato, don't want them crossed.
